Nice to meet you
I believe therapy should be a supportive space where you feel seen, understood, and encouraged to grow. I’ve worked with BIPOC clients across residential, day treatment, intensive outpatient, and outpatient settings. I take a client-centered, collaborative approach and enjoy supporting clients navigating dual diagnosis, relationship stressors, life transitions, stress, depression, and anxiety. My goal is for you to leave each session feeling empowered to move forward.
